About Harry Potter To Kenja No Ishi (japan)

Harry Potter to Kenja no Ishi came out in 2001 for the Game Boy Color, developed by Artdink. It was one of many games released for the handheld during its final years, a time when developers were still finding interesting ways to use the limited color palette. This particular title was only officially available in Japan.

You control Harry Potter as he explores Hogwarts and its surrounding areas from an overhead view. The main goal is to find the Sorcerer's Stone by navigating through a series of connected rooms and dungeons. Signature mechanics include screen by screen exploration, where each new area loads as you move, and a simple combat system where you use a sword or a bow to defeat enemies. The pacing is deliberate, and the game can be quite difficult due to its maze-like corridors and limited resources. It feels like a condensed, straightforward adventure from that era.
